Shepherd Baseball Sweeps Salem

NUTTER FORT, W.Va. – Shepherd University (3-7) swept Salem University (1-6) in baseball doubleheader action at Frank Loria Field on Monday. Shepherd gained a 5-2 win in game one and added a 6-3 triumph in the nightcap.

Salem took a 1-0 lead in the first inning in game one on an RBI-single by Reese Rinna.

Shepherd plated three runs in the third on a solo blast by junior outfielder Bodie Pullen (Winchester, Va./James Wood) and a two-run single by redshirt freshman outfielder Colin Ahart (Pennsauken, N.J./St. Joseph Academy).

The Tigers cut the lead to 3-2 in the sixth as Hunter Rose singled and later scored on a sacrifice fly by Max Atkinson.

Shepherd answered back with a pair of runs in the top of the seventh as junior catcher Austin Sofran (Swedesboro, N.J./St. Augustine Prep) reached on a hit-by-pitch and later scored on a double off the bat of sophomore infielder Nathaniel Brookshire (Winchester, Va./Millbrook). Brookshire scored on a sacrifice fly by Pullen.

Sophomore pitcher Thor Hildebrand (Glen Burnie, Md./North County) (3.0 IP, 4 H, 1 R, 0 ER, 1 K, 1 BB) (1-0) gained the win. Redshirt-junior pitcher Oliver Leonard (Kennebunk, Maine/Kennebunk) (1.0 IP, 0 H, 0 R, 1 K, 0 BB) picked up the save. Otho Savage (3.0 IP, 4 H, 3 ER, 3 K, 2 BB) (0-2) took the loss for Salem.

Rinna hit a two-run homer in the first in the nightcap to give the Tigers a 2-0 advantage.

Shepherd cut the lead to 2-1 in the second on an RBI-double by junior shortstop Ethan Burgreen (Winchester, Va./Millbrook).

After Salem added a run in the third, Shepherd plated a pair as redshirt-sophomore outfielder Ethan Jones (Oakton, Va./Oakton) belted an RBI-triple and later scored on a wild pitch to tie the game.

Shepherd took advantage of a hit, an error, two walks, and a balk to score three runs in the seventh and earn the sweep. 

Redshirt senior pitcher Eli Lam (Elkton, Va./Spotswood/Patrick Henry Community College) (2.0 IP, 2 H, 0 R, 4 K, 1 BB) (1-1) earned the win. Zack Kendall (2.0 IP, 1 H, 3 R, 2 ER, 0 K, 3 BB)) (0-1) took the loss for the Tigers.
                         
The Rams return to action on March 4 when they host West Liberty for a noon doubleheader.
